American Eagle Outfitters Announces Mary Boland, Chief Financial and Administrative Officer, to Retire

PITTSBURGH–(BUSINESS WIRE)–American Eagle Outfitters, Inc. (NYSE:AEO) today announced that Mary
Boland, Chief Financial and Administrative Officer, plans to retire
effective April 1, 2016. An active search for a successor is underway.

In the interim, Scott Hurd, the company’s Chief Accounting Officer, will
lead the day-to-day management of the finance team and assume the role
of Interim Chief Financial Officer.

About American Eagle Outfitters, Inc.

American Eagle Outfitters, Inc. (NYSE: AEO) is a leading global
specialty retailer offering high-quality, on-trend clothing, accessories
and personal care products at affordable prices under its American Eagle
Outfitters® and Aerie® brands. The company operates more than 1,000
stores in the United States, Canada, Mexico, China, Hong Kong and the
United Kingdom, and ships to 81 countries worldwide through its
websites. American Eagle Outfitters and Aerie merchandise also is
available at 141 international stores operated by licensees in 22
countries. For more information, please visit www.ae.com.
